Looks good to me, it just needs an update to the manual describing
the new options.

It's too bad that the conditionals checking for the dialect have
to be repeated throughout the front end.  They're implied by
the new option enumerator passed to pedwarn().  If the diagnostic
subsystem had access to cxx_dialect the check could be done there
and all the other conditionals could be avoided.  An alternative
to that would be to add a new wrapper to the C++ front end, like
cxxdialect_pedwarn, to do the checking before calling pedwarn
(or, more likely, emit_diagnostic_valist).
